[DirectionalSpecular][PrecomputedRealtime] Objects are overexposed if Precomputed Realtime GI is used
Steps to reproduce:
1. Open attached project "766533.zip" using 5.4.0b4
2. Build lights
3. Notice that objects are overexposed - "b4.png" attached
4. Open attached project "766533.zip" using 5.4.0b3
5. Build lights
6. Notice that objects look normal - "b3.png" attached
Not reproducible with: 5.4.0b3
Reproduced with: 5.4.0b4
